Composite Number

74964

74964 is a even composite number that follows 74963 and precedes 74965. It is composed of 12 distinct factors: 1, 2, 3, 4, 6, 12, 6247, 12494, 18741, 24988, 37482, 74964. Its prime factorization can be written as 2^2 × 3 × 6247. 74964 is classified as a abundant number based on the sum of its proper divisors. In computer science, 74964 is represented as 10010010011010100 in binary and 124D4 in hexadecimal.

Divisibility Insights
  • Divisible by 2

    74964 ends in 4, so it is even.

  • Divisible by 3

    The digit sum 30 is a multiple of 3.

  • Divisible by 4

    The last two digits 64 form a multiple of 4.

  • Divisible by 5

    74964 does not end in 0 or 5.

  • Divisible by 6

    It meets the tests for both 2 and 3, so it is divisible by 6.

  • Divisible by 9

    The digit sum 30 is not a multiple of 9.

  • Divisible by 10

    74964 does not end in 0.

  • Divisible by 11

    The alternating digit sum 10 is not a multiple of 11.
